Express Warranty
A seller's promise or guarantee that a product will meet a certain level of quality and reliability, explicitly stated in a contract or by implication through advertising.
Res Ipsa Loquitur
A legal doctrine that allows for the presumption of negligence in a case where the accident occurring is the type which normally does not happen in the absence of negligence.
Product Liability
The legal liability a manufacturer or seller incurs for producing or selling a faulty product resulting in injury or harm to a consumer.
